微信小程序:云服务器与云托管的抉择
结论:
在当今数字化时代,微信小程序已成为企业与用户互动的重要工具。然而,选择将其部署在云服务器还是云托管,取决于多种因素,包括成本、安全性、可扩展性、运维需求以及技术熟练度等。没有绝对的最佳选择,只有最适合特定业务场景的解决方案。
分析探讨:
微信小程序的开发和部署策略是每个企业或开发者必须面对的问题。在这个问题上,云服务器和云托管都是可行的选择,但各有优缺点。
首先,云服务器,如阿里云、腾讯云等,提供的是基础设施即服务(IaaS),企业可以完全控制服务器环境,包括操作系统、存储、网络配置等。对于需要高度定制化和控制的企业,或者有复杂后端需求的微信小程序,云服务器可能是更好的选择。此外,云服务器的性能通常较强,适合处理大流量和高并发情况。然而,这也意味着更高的运维成本和复杂性,需要专业的IT团队进行管理和维护。
相比之下,云托管,如AWS Amplify、Google Firebase等,提供了平台即服务(PaaS)或全托管服务,企业无需关心底层基础设施,只需关注应用开发。这种方式简化了运维,降低了技术门槛,更适合小型企业和初创公司,或是对快速上线和迭代有需求的项目。然而,云托管的灵活性和可定制性相对较弱,可能无法满足所有复杂的应用场景。
在安全性方面,两者都有一定的保障,但具体取决于服务商的安全措施。云服务器需要企业自行管理安全更新和防护,而云托管通常会提供更全面的安全服务,但可能在数据隐私方面有所限制。
在成本方面,云服务器的初期投入可能较低,但长期运维费用可能会增加。云托管则通常以使用量计费,初期成本可能较高,但长期来看,如果使用量稳定,可能会更经济。
总的来说,微信小程序的部署选择应基于业务规模、技术能力、预算、安全需求以及对灵活性和控制程度的考量。对于大型企业或技术实力雄厚的团队,云服务器可能更能发挥其优势;而对于初创公司或希望快速上线的小型项目,云托管可能更具吸引力。在做出决定时,重要的是理解每种选项的核心特点,并确保其符合你的业务目标和长远规划。
CDNK博客